Day and Night Low-light-level Imaging and Tracking System Based on EBAPS
As a digital low-light imaging device, the electron-bombarded active pixel sensor (EBAPS) has the ability to obtain a clear image under both day and night conditions. Compared with visible light and infrared imaging, its imaging system has the advantages of miniaturization, low cost, and low power consumption, making it a popular research topic in the field of imaging. Adopting a fully domestic EBAPS low-light device concept and FPGA as the main processor, an EBAPS device driving circuit, image processing and tracking circuit, and display circuit were completed. Using an optical system that satisfied the requirements of both day and night, a miniaturized handheld imaging and tracking system was built. The experimental results show that the EBAPS imaging system realizes clear imaging and good tracking effects under illuminance conditions ranging from 1 × 10-4 to 1 × 104 lx.
